About The Position

As the Executive Director, Client Business Lead you will play a critical role as the strategic thought leader and trusted advisor to client counterparts and represent the voice of the client within Hearts & Science. The role will oversee a pod of clients and/or client teams that will be focused on driving inspired media solutions. This position will necessitate an analytical and creative thinker with high EQ and a track record of leading high-performing integrated teams. The Client Business Leads are change drivers and innovators, who know when to take smart risks and make tough decisions to deliver results. They are inspiring and inclusive leaders who give their team with a track record of building and managing diverse "client-first" teams.
